The Lenovo computer bios setting USB boot method is as follows:

1. Open the Lenovo laptop, press F2 when the startup screen appears to enter the bios setting interface, use the left and right arrow keys to move the cursor to security Menu, then use the up and down arrow keys to move the cursor to secure boot and press Enter to execute;

2. Then use the up and down arrow keys to move the cursor to the secure boot option, press Enter to execute, in the pop-up small In the window, use the up and down arrow keys to move the cursor to the disable option, and press the Enter key to confirm the selection;

3. Then press the esc key to return to the bios setting main interface, and use the left and right arrow keys to move the cursor to the startup menu. Use the up and down arrow keys to move the cursor to the UEFI/Legacy Boot option, and press Enter to execute;

4. In the small window that pops up, use the up and down arrow keys to move the cursor to the legacy only option, and press Return Press the car key to execute. After completing the above operations, press the F10 key and a query window will pop up. Click yes to save and exit;

5. After restarting the computer, press the F12 shortcut key to enter the startup idea when the startup screen appears. Select the window, and now you can see the option of USB drive USB disk startup. Move the cursor to the USB disk startup item and press the Enter key (you need to insert a bootable USB disk first).

No response when msi selects USB disk boot point?

Usually the USB boot disk is not created successfully. Two requirements: the security option turns off the secure boot mode. If uefi is selected, the u boot disk needs to be made into a mode that supports uefi.

What should I do if the f9 of Biostar motherboard does not display the USB disk to boot?

Biostar motherboard f9 does not display the U disk boot, you can try the following methods to solve it:

Check whether the U disk is normal: try to use other U disks to see if it can be recognized by the Biostar motherboard. If other USB flash drives can be recognized, the problem may lie with this USB flash drive. You can try formatting the USB flash drive and then recreating the boot disk.

Check whether there is a problem with the USB socket: Check whether the U disk and USB socket are well connected. If there is a problem with the socket, the U disk may not be able to start.

BIOS setting problem: Refer to the BIOS setting tutorial to set the USB disk startup items.

The motherboard supports USB boot but just can’t boot?

Using a U disk to boot may cause startup failure due to many reasons. The most common factor is that the U disk itself is not properly started.

Mainly reflected in the complete writing of the hard disk boot record. In many online tutorials, this step is easily ignored. The result is that the U disk cannot start the system normally. After loading the image file into the USB flash drive, click the portable boot button at the back, select to write a new hard disk master boot record, select USB-HDD in it, and wait until the hard disk master boot record is recorded before starting. Some motherboards have different compatibility with U disk mode. If you cannot start using USB-HDD, you can try various U disk boot modes such as USB-ZIP or USB-CDROM.
